Overview of LCMXO2-4000HC-5BG256I – MachXO2 Field Programmable Gate Array (FPGA)

The LCMXO2-4000HC-5BG256I is a MachXO2 series FPGA from Lattice Semiconductor, delivering flexible on-chip logic and I/O resources in a 256-ball LFBGA package. Designed for industrial-grade applications, the device integrates thousands of logic elements, embedded memory, and a broad range of programmable I/O options to address glue logic, interface bridging, and system control tasks.

This device supports a single power supply range of 2.375 V to 3.465 V and operates across an industrial temperature range of -40 °C to 100 °C, making it suitable for long-life embedded systems that require non-volatile, reconfigurable logic and diverse I/O capabilities.

Key Features

  • Core Logic Approximately 4,320 logic elements provide the configurable logic fabric needed for glue logic, state machines, and custom peripheral functions.
  • Embedded Memory Approximately 94 kbits of on-chip RAM (94,208 bits total) for distributed storage and buffering within user logic.
  • I/O Density & Flexibility 206 I/Os available in the 256-ball package with programmable sysIO buffer support across multiple signaling standards, enabling diverse interface implementations.
  • On-Chip Non-Volatile Storage Family-level on-chip user flash memory (series supports up to 256 kbits) for instant-on configuration and field updates via supported interfaces.
  • Clocking and PLLs Family devices offer multiple primary clocks and up to two analog PLLs for flexible clock management and fractional-n frequency synthesis.
  • High-Speed I/O Support Pre-engineered source-synchronous I/O with DDR registers in I/O cells and gearing support for display and memory interfaces (family features include DDR/DDR2/LPDDR-related support).
  • Power and Reliability Single-supply operation across 2.375 V–3.465 V and industrial temperature rating (-40 °C to 100 °C); RoHS compliant.
  • Package 256-ball caBGA / LFBGA footprint (14 mm × 14 mm) for compact board integration while providing high I/O count.

Typical Applications

  • Interface Bridging and Glue Logic Use the FPGA to consolidate multiple peripherals, perform protocol translation, and implement custom control logic between subsystems.
  • Display and Video I/O Gearing and DDR I/O support from the family enable signal conditioning and timing adaptation for display interfaces and related workflows.
  • Memory Interface Control Dedicated DDR/DDR2/LPDDR memory support and on-chip FIFO logic make the device suitable for buffering and timing-critical memory interfaces.
  • Embedded System Control Implement timers, counters, SPI/I²C masters/slaves, and glue functions for industrial controllers and instrumentation.
